浅析航标附属电设备的可行性试用检测方法

【摘要】:为建设海洋强国,提高海洋资源开发能力,发展海洋经济,保护海洋生态环境,坚决维护国家海洋权益。近年来,我国在南海海域大力发展港口及海岛建设,催生了一系列的导助航设施。如何提高航标导助航性能,减少航标设备经济成本投入,科学管理航标设备成为航标工作重点关注的问题。本文基于航标国际规范、国家标准及行业标准的有关规定,结合航标附属设备实际使用情况,删减并归纳了航标附属电设备的检测标准,使之成为方便可行的检测方法。
